    From Today's Railways (UK) October 2021.

    STEVE WHITE THE NEW MD FOR SOUTHEASTERN.

    Govia has appointed Steve White as the new MD of Southeastern.  Mr White moves across from Govia Thameslink Railway where he was Deputy Chief executive for the last three years.  David Statham, his predecessor at Southeastern, has moved to Go-Ahead Group's executive team as its Strategy Director.  He had been MD of Southeasern since September 2014.  Meanwhile, Go-Ahead has announced that Christian Schreyer will be its new Chief Executive to replace David Brown.

    Bexhill and Battle MP Huw Merriman, who chairs the Transport Select Committee, told the BBC: "I understand the Serious Fraud Office will be involved in this, so there is a limit to what I can say."

    He said: "We need confidence in our railways right now, and if there appears to be evidence of wrongdoing, then it is right to sweep away."

    The Serious Fraud Office said: "We are aware of the matter but can neither confirm nor deny interest."
